With support for a comprehensive range of wireless and network technologies, Ubiquios by Virscient is a low-memory/low energy software stack that allows you to choose the best-in-class transceivers for your application. Now you, too, can rapidly deliver a compact and secure product to market.
Ubiquios is packed with features that make it easy to deliver standards-based connectivity into IoT products. Read more about the key feature groups below.
Ubiquios includes a modular and extensible Wi‑Fi stack with an efficient WPA supplicant, STA/AP management entities, and MAC/MLME functionality to easily support FullMAC or SoftMAC transceivers.
Ubiquios makes it easy to include cellular 2G/3G/4G/5G modems, LTE Cat‑M and NB‑IoT, and other LPWAN technologies. Seamlessly integrate cellular and other IP bearers under the same protocol stack.
Ubiquios enables low-power short-range mesh networking. Proprietary long-range and outdoor mesh networks can be supported via other radio technologies.
Ubiquios’ compact TCP/IP stack includes auxiliary protocols (DHCP, DNS, NTP, etc) and industry-standard security (TLS/OCSP). Ubiquios also supports key zero-conf enablers Bonjour and UPnP.
Ubiquios provides secure connectivity to the cloud via HTTP and MQTT. Integrated cloud agents make it simple to connect your device to public cloud platforms including AWS, Azure IoT Hub, and IBM Cloud.
With internal support/development bandwidth focused on your Tier 1 customers, innovative silicon and IP vendors can leverage our compact footprint and portability to save money and accelerate your time to market for highly-integrated IoT solutions.
Ubiquios’ flexible licensing and pricing models can satisfy often-divergent customer needs and drive additional silicon sales volume with minimal fuss.
By using Ubiquios, smart system integrators and ODMs build platforms that allow you to maximise reuse and deliver rapidly on customers’ diverse needs as they arise, with a robust and supported connectivity stack.
Using Ubiquios as the abstraction for your connectivity allows you to take a building block approach to combining transceivers, MCUs, and other application-specific logic and software modules.
Great product developers focus on differentiating their products through its design and user features, rather than sinking precious engineering resources reinventing the wheel on connectivity.
Ubiquios provides a turn-key solution for your wireless connectivity needs, with broad support for transceiver silicon and modules from market leaders such as Infineon, Murata, Laird, TI, and Qualcomm.
Whether you’re embarking on development of an consumer wireless product, or building highly integrated silicon solutions for mass market application, Ubiquios can help you succeed! Here are some reasons why Ubiquios is a great choice for your connectivity project.
Ubiquios provides every layer you need between radio and application, including blocks such as L2CAP, RFCOMM and GATT, Wi‑Fi SoftMAC and WPA supplicant, TCP/IP, TLS, MQTT, and AWS, Azure and other cloud agents.
Ubiquios is built from the ground up for minimum Flash/RAM footprint. Complete IoT solutions including SoftMAC Wi‑Fi, TCP/IP, TLS, and MQTT can be deployed in less than 128 kB Flash and 32 kB RAM.
Ubiquios makes the common case easy, and the complex case possible. Our APIs are clean and well-documented, and make it easy to implement robust, low-power connectivity with minimum development effort.
Ubiquios has compact implementations of industry-leading security protocols including WPA-Enterprise and TLS (with OCSP), including support for private key offload to hardware secure elements or other trusted modules.
Ubiquios protocol stacks can run on bare metal for low-footprint, low-power applications, or easily integrate into common embedded RTOS platforms such as FreeRTOS, Arm Mbed OS, ThreadX, or Wind River VxWorks.
Ubiquios was designed and optimised for 32-bit microcontrollers including Arm Cortex-M, RISC-V, and MIPS/PIC32, but has been deployed on a wide range of open or proprietary 32-bit and 16-bit cores – including some peculiar ones.
Let’s talk about how Ubiquios can accelerate your path to market